Understanding Long Term Drug Rehab in Newberg, Oregon

To stop yourself from relapsing back to your previous alcohol and drug use habits as well as address any co-occurring psychological disorder you may have, you might find that you need to do the following:

  • Institute new approaches you can use to manage your condition
  • Pinpoint all life problems that may aggravate your psychological issues and work through them
  • Identify the impact and effects of your addiction on your life
  • Develop ways to stop yourself from giving in to the temptation to start abusing alcohol and drugs
  • Develop ways to deal with any reemergence of the symptoms of your drug and alcohol abuse
  • Understand your drug addiction as a process and concept

Because there are so many things for you to learn, you may find it more useful to spend more time in a Newberg drug and alcohol addiction treatment center. Although short-term drug and alcohol rehab might also provide you with a foundation for your rehab, it might not have ample support to make sure that you take these lessons and begin using them in your life.

In such instances, therefore, you may benefit from long term drug and alcohol rehab. In many instances, this type of drug and alcohol addiction rehab is offered on an inpatient or residential basis to ensure that you are in a helpful environment without all triggers that could cause you to begin using harmful substances.

During long term rehab, therefore, you will get the robust level of care and support you need for an extended duration. As such, the treatments will assist you in laying the groundwork that you can depend on to achieve sobriety in the long run.

Overall, long term drug rehab will offer 24/7 oversight, care, and management over an extended period. At the end of the addiction rehab in Newberg, OR., you should have retained enough knowledge and skills to begin leading a more productive, sober lifestyle.
